summ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orAndreas Sturmlechner <asturm@gentoo.org>2017-04-08 17:32:56 +0200
committerAndreas Sturmlechner <asturm@gentoo.org>2017-04-08 17:33:41 +0200
commit772d5a9a522abd8a460b5be807bf568635a9abf0 (patch)
treeecf9649a57c723b7b09a2921555ba446a029701b /kde-frameworks/kservice
parentmedia-gfx/gimp: Sync 9999, move to https (diff)
downloadgentoo-772d5a9a522abd8a460b5be807bf568635a9abf0.tar.gz
gentoo-772d5a9a522abd8a460b5be807bf568635a9abf0.tar.bz2
gentoo-772d5a9a522abd8a460b5be807bf568635a9abf0.zip
kde-frameworks: Add KDE Frameworks 5.33.0 release
Package-Manager: Portage-2.3.3, Repoman-2.3.1
Diffstat (limited to 'kde-frameworks/kservice')
-rw-r--r--kde-frameworks/kservice/Manifest1
-rw-r--r--kde-frameworks/kservice/kservice-5.33.0.ebuild46
2 files changed, 47 insertions, 0 deletions
diff --git a/kde-frameworks/kservice/Manifest b/kde-frameworks/kservice/Manifest
index 2b4907ae024b..066d545ce0fd 100644
--- a/kde-frameworks/kservice/Manifest
+++ b/kde-frameworks/kservice/Manifest
@@ -1,2 +1,3 @@
DIST kservice-5.29.0.tar.xz 2769092 SHA256 8796ff345f09ac422abbc752b441ceee2f6113a591e68e7c10e4a2cad9838010 SHA512 fd23cf5facd89d8b219713f191f2aaa7ddd19f54f05549c2c9644a144ba4e67b76787ccec36c78da4083cf815981c2db0b7b24a553065e60f5f59c7eecc1b98a WHIRLPOOL 43b1adafdffcaa58072b683898f33881a1715b7c9d42764001a24711fdf4c82b460a04af9b67511ea28583030343f129fae065e434324ea1f16a72f743a82ab2
DIST kservice-5.32.0.tar.xz 247948 SHA256 189c9da0bb48961d16db17540093b68fd4ae061590c34f4cea35dfaba51ab30b SHA512 e6db0b65b4216c54ca714e3cefd9847c02ab5330ee3da6b7199b6b034ef55cec4647c5181761070ac14b3c74def586a0645c3165cb71cca41e01426dcd36b6a5 WHIRLPOOL ebe7f33cef17c235c77313e32b923b301833acb65b54ec7b61bf6a9418f7bd88c7c02240b11017acc79e48f3f5861fafeccf6be0aa65f18a091183c137f0129d
+DIST kservice-5.33.0.tar.xz 248080 SHA256 f020f4146e87716cc2bb90214e1830faa46e745adf411bd1fe1b5ba6a122184b SHA512 d81f3eb963221c89590a0e5815ddbced2ec2a71c9bbde26379c073bbc151716a25fa4a3a351af2f2afc58d01f4849c6e1d0fe3a30ab28102633880e9d29256b4 WHIRLPOOL 5bf50836a15227b7b0005c2622bdefdd1c6cf61066fbb360f9d853333aaf31e7250cbc33227662bd14f6bdcedbadc3a9106318e2fca45c710fc2c3e6501ec606
diff --git a/kde-frameworks/kservice/kservice-5.33.0.ebuild b/kde-frameworks/kservice/kservice-5.33.0.ebuild
new file mode 100644
index 000000000000..a15cb1d3360b
--- /dev/null
+++ b/kde-frameworks/kservice/kservice-5.33.0.ebuild
@@ -0,0 +1,46 @@
+# Copyright 1999-2017 Gentoo Foundation
+# Distributed under the terms of the GNU General Public License v2
+
+EAPI=6
+
+inherit kde5
+
+DESCRIPTION="Advanced plugin and service introspection"
+LICENSE="LGPL-2 LGPL-2.1+"
+KEYWORDS="~amd64 ~arm ~x86"
+IUSE="+man"
+
+RDEPEND="
+ $(add_frameworks_dep kconfig)
+ $(add_frameworks_dep kcoreaddons)
+ $(add_frameworks_dep kcrash)
+ $(add_frameworks_dep kdbusaddons)
+ $(add_frameworks_dep ki18n)
+ $(add_qt_dep qtdbus)
+ $(add_qt_dep qtxml)
+"
+DEPEND="${RDEPEND}
+ sys-devel/bison
+ sys-devel/flex
+ man? ( $(add_frameworks_dep kdoctools) )
+ test? ( $(add_qt_dep qtconcurrent) )
+"
+
+# requires running kde environment
+RESTRICT+=" test"
+
+src_configure() {
+ local mycmakeargs=(
+ -DAPPLICATIONS_MENU_NAME=kf5-applications.menu
+ $(cmake-utils_use_find_package man KF5DocTools)
+ )
+
+ kde5_src_configure
+}
+
+src_install() {
+ kde5_src_install
+
+ # bug 596316
+ dosym /etc/xdg/menus/kf5-applications.menu /etc/xdg/menus/applications.menu
+}